Okay Amy- ummm a little late in posting and I am sure you have gone already but here is the info...
There were warnings when we went too but they were mainly for the more popular border crossings and we went south thru Arizona and drove thru never stopped no issue. We flew to Phoenix and then traveled south and I can't remember the border town we crossed thru but it was out in the middle of the desert. We then drove 1 hour south to Puerto Penasco- Rocky Point which is on the tip of the Sea of Cortez. It was about 85 everyday and really nice. The only thing I missed was foliage as you are out in the desert. Obviously on the way back we were stopped but everyone had all their passports ready and we went right on thru. I am thinking maybe it was Lukeville where we crossed. We did get Mexican insurance a little way before we crossed the border and we bought a ton of stuff at Costco and then brought it down though their stores had enough too.
